Cambodia, Thailand vows truce commitment to China
The trilateral meeting took place in Shanghai on Wednesday, bringing together Chinese Vice Foreign Minister Sun Weidong and envoys from both Southeast Asian nations.
During the discussions, Cambodia and Thailand restated their intention to respect the ceasefire and acknowledged China’s ongoing efforts in helping de-escalate tensions between them.
The gathering was described as open, cordial, and constructive. The statement also emphasized that China has consistently played a positive and facilitating role in promoting a peaceful settlement to border disputes between the two neighbors. The Shanghai meeting marks the latest step in China’s diplomatic engagement on the matter.
